Output 60594102a722c2993148fe713951921eb6b8fd13d33b729c1a9742f9fec93604:0

value
357192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e33dff2c4effd60ded32ba3a0722a7cc830230c OP_EQUAL
address
32z7XZ4N7BBFhmqPy4RtSHDmqvmKL5C9tv
transaction
60594102a722c2993148fe713951921eb6b8fd13d33b729c1a9742f9fec93604
confirmations
121573
spent
true